Microchip Technology Unveils Industry's Fastest 1 Mb SPI Serial EEPROM

Microchip Technology Inc., a leading provider of microcontroller and analog semiconductors, today announced the 25AA1024 and 25LC1024 (25XX1024)—the fastest (20 MHz) 1 Megabit (Mb) SPI serial EEPROM devices in the industry. The Company also announced the 25AA128, 25LC128, 25AA512 and 25LC512 (25XX128/512) 128 Kbit and 512 Kbit devices today, meaning Microchip now provides serial EEPROMs across the entire SPI memory-density range (1 Kbit – 1 Mbit).

Microchip's KEELOQ Security Resistant to Theoretical Code Cracking

Microchip Technology Inc., a leading provider of microcontroller and analog semiconductors, today announced that, after a thorough evaluation of recent claims made by cryptographic researchers, the Company concluded that its KEELOQ security system, in its recommended real-world implementation, is secure.
